Abstract

The embodiment of the invention discloses a wireless communication method which comprises the steps that a first beacon frame is generated at the first time point by an access point, wherein the first beacon frame contains first competitive stage duration information which represents the duration of a fist competition stage; the first beacon frame is transmitted according to the broadcasting period of the first beacon frame; a second beacon frame is generated at the second time point, wherein the second beacon frame contains second competition stage duration information which represents the duration of a second competition stage; the second beacon frame is transmitted according to the broadcast period of the second beacon frame. The duration of the first competition stage is different from the duration of the second competition stage. The invention further discloses an access point device. By the adoption of the wireless communication method and the access point device, the transmission period of the beacon frames is reduced greatly, effective communication time is increased, and the effective utilization rate of spectra is increased.

Background technology
Along with the progress of ICT (information and communication technology), various wireless communication technologys are recently developed.In the middle of these wireless communication technologys, wireless lan (wlan) is that one can be by being used portable terminal (such as intelligent mobile terminal, panel computer, portable media player etc.) in family or enterprise or the technology with wireless mode online in the region of special services being provided.
Availability of frequency spectrum efficiency in existing Wireless Fidelity (WIreless Fidelity, Wi-Fi) technology is the hot issue that people pay close attention to; Current through experiment statistics, analyze website (Station in Wi-Fi technology, STA) with access point (Access Point, AP) set up and initially connect and communicate institute's transmission frame in process, discovery management frames (as, probe response (Probe response) frame etc.) proportion that accounts for is very large, shows that access point is carrying out the initial action connecting in the most of the time of communication, and the shared proportion of the active data traffic is little; Because the proportion of the management frames sending in communication process (for the wireless initial connection of equipment room) is excessive, the time that makes to carry out valid data transmission is very few, causes effective utilization ratio of frequency spectrum very low.

Referring to Fig. 1, be the schematic flow sheet of wireless communications method provided by the invention, the method comprises:
Step S100: access point is at very first time dot generation the first beacon frame, and described the first beacon frame comprises the first competition phase duration information, described the first competition phase duration information represents the first competition phase duration;
Particularly, this very first time point can be some time points of communication process, the first competition phase duration information that this first beacon frame comprises can be illustrated in the one section of duration sending after this first beacon frame, and website can obtain channel resource by the mode of competition; For example, the broadcast cycle of this first beacon frame is 200ms, the first competition phase duration is 40ms, and the first competition phase duration information that the first beacon frame comprises so can be illustrated in the 40ms time sending after this first beacon frame, and website can obtain channel resource by the mode of competition; In the follow-up 160ms time, it is non-competing phase duration.
Step S102: send described the first beacon frame according to the broadcast cycle of described the first beacon frame;
Step S104: generate the second beacon frame at the second time point, described the second beacon frame comprises the second competition phase duration information, described the second competition phase duration information represents the second competition phase duration;
Particularly, this second time point is the time point that is different from above-mentioned very first time point, be that access point can be according to the setting of self or Rule of judgment in communication process, generate the second beacon frame at another time point, the second competition phase duration difference that the second competition phase duration information that this second beacon frame comprises represents and above-mentioned the first competition phase duration.
Step S106: send described the second beacon frame according to the broadcast cycle of described the second beacon frame.
Particularly, for example, the broadcast cycle of this first beacon frame is 200ms, the first competition phase duration is 40ms, and the broadcast cycle of this first beacon frame is 200ms, and the second competition phase duration is 20ms, after Competition adjustment phase duration has reduced so, the quantity of the management frames that website sends in the second competition phase duration has obtained minimizing, thereby has increased effective call duration time, has improved the effective rate of utilization of frequency spectrum.
It should be noted that, the first beacon frame in the embodiment of the present invention and the broadcast cycle of the second beacon frame can be identical can be not identical yet, preferably, the broadcast cycle of the first beacon frame is identical with the broadcast cycle of the second beacon frame.
Further, before step S104, the embodiment of the present invention can also comprise: the load state information of access point monitors self, and adjust described the first competition phase duration according to described load state information, the first competition phase duration after adjusting is as described the second competition phase duration.
Particularly, this load state information can comprise at least one or combination in any:
Concentrate the quantity information of setting up the website being initially connected with described access point in basic service;
Basic service concentrate set up the initial website being connected with described access point on average tell the amount of gulping down; Or
Concentrate the average connection data speed of setting up the website being initially connected with described access point in basic service.
Again at length, for example (,) access point can dynamically adjust the first competition phase duration according to the load condition of self.For example, concentrate single access point can only support at most 30 websites in same basic service, access point can preset monitoring adjustment algorithm so, in the time monitoring present load quantity and exceed 15 websites, the first competition phase duration is turned down, and the first competition phase duration after adjusting is as the second competition phase duration of the second beacon frame, thereby control communicating pair sends the quantity of management frames, increase effective call duration time, improve the effective rate of utilization of frequency spectrum.
Again further, described according to described load state information adjust described first competition phase duration can comprise: the size of more described load state information and predetermined threshold value; In the time that the magnitude relationship of described load state information and predetermined threshold value changes, adjust described the first competition phase duration; In the time that the magnitude relationship of described load state information and predetermined threshold value does not change, maintain described the first competition phase duration.
Particularly, being included in basic service taking this load state information concentrates the quantity of setting up the website being initially connected with described access point as example, describe: suppose that predetermined threshold value is 15, the quantity of the website being originally initially connected with access point foundation is less than 15, if the website quantity of monitoring is always lower than 15 so, maintain this first competition phase duration, when the website quantity of monitoring is higher than 15 time, adjust this first competition phase duration, the first competition phase duration can be turned down, as the second competition phase duration; Or the quantity of the website being originally initially connected with access point foundation is greater than 15, if the website quantity of monitoring is greater than 15 so always, maintain this first competition phase duration, in the time that the website quantity of monitoring is less than 15, adjust this first competition phase duration, the first competition phase duration can be tuned up, as the second competition phase duration.
Again further, the embodiment of the present invention can also comprise: be provided with at least two predetermined threshold value, each predetermined threshold value correspondence is provided with competition phase duration separately; In the time that the magnitude relationship of described load state information and predetermined threshold value changes, adjusting described the first competition phase duration comprises: when the maximum preset threshold value reaching when described load state information changes, described the first competition phase duration is adjusted into competition phase duration corresponding to maximum preset threshold value reaching.
Particularly, predetermined threshold value in the embodiment of the present invention can also have multiple, and each threshold value is to there being beacon frame broadcast cycle separately, being included in basic service taking this load state information equally concentrates the quantity of setting up the website being initially connected with described access point as example, describe, as following table:
Predetermined threshold value Competition phase duration (ms)
20 10
15 25
10 40
In the time that the website quantity of monitoring is 12, adjusting this first competition phase duration is 40ms, as the second competition phase duration; In the time that the website quantity of monitoring is 16, adjusting this first competition phase duration is 25ms, as the second competition phase duration; In the time that the website quantity of monitoring is 25, adjusting this first competition phase duration is 10ms, as the second competition phase duration.
Again further, the competition of second in embodiment of the present invention phase duration can be adjusted into zero, and this second beacon frame can comprise controlled competition phase information element; This controlled competition phase information element comprises the information that is used to indicate the 3rd competition time started phase and end time;
Particularly, can preset certain threshold value, when arriving after this threshold value, the second competition phase duration is adjusted into zero, and be provided with controlled competition phase information element in this second beacon frame, to indicate the information of the 3rd competition time started phase and end time.Intelligible, access point and website can be consulted to be scheduled in advance, only has the Wireless Fidelity standard of future generation of support (High Efficiency WLAN, HEW) website just can parse the controlled competition phase information element in this second beacon frame, then obtain the information of the 3rd competition time started phase and end time, and in the duration of the 3rd competition phase competitive channel resource; At length, there are following two kinds of embodiment:
The first:;
Particularly, support HEW and set up with access point the initial website being connected receive access point send the second beacon frame after, resolve this second beacon frame and obtain controlled competition phase information element, get the 3rd competition time started phase and end time (now, the second competition phase duration that the second beacon frame is corresponding concerning this website is exactly the duration of the 3rd competition phase), in the time knowing that access point has buffer memory downlink data to be sent, can in the duration of the 3rd competition phase, send power-save poll frame (PS-Poll) by the mode of competition and obtain downlink data.
The second: access point is zero adjusting the second competition phase duration, and before sending the second beacon frame according to the broadcast cycle of the second beacon frame, support the website of HEW to initiate to set up initial connection to this access point,, access point receives the probe request of supporting that the website of HEW sends, and returns to probing response frame to this website; But after access point sends the second beacon frame according to the broadcast cycle of the second beacon frame, also do not set up complete initial connection with this access point, after access point sends the second beacon frame according to the broadcast cycle of the second beacon frame, the embodiment of the present invention can also comprise so: receive described website and connect and set up message frame at the initial network entry of the interim transmission of described the 3rd competition; Connect and set up message frame according to described initial network entry, set up and be initially connected with described website.
Particularly, this website receives after the second beacon frame of access point transmission, resolve this second beacon frame and obtain controlled competition phase information element, got for the 3rd competition time started phase and end time, then in the duration of the 3rd competition phase, send the initial network entry connections such as association request frame, open authentication claim frame or authentication request frames by the mode of competition and set up message frame, access point receives this initial network entry connection and sets up after message frame, completes initial establishment of connection with this website.
Will be understood that, in above-mentioned two kinds of embodiment, do not support the website of HEW receiving after this second beacon frame, resolve this second beacon frame and find not compete phase duration, be non-competing phase duration entirely, therefore can not send initial network entry connection to website and set up message frame.Initial network entry connection in the embodiment of the present invention is set up message frame and is included but not limited to probe request, association request frame, open authentication claim frame, authentication request frames etc.
